The Renal Physiology of Pendrin-Positive Intercalated Cells

Intercalated cells (ICs) are found in the connecting tubule and the collecting duct. Of the three IC subtypes identified, type B intercalated cells are one of the best characterized and known to mediate Cl(−) absorption and HCO(3)(−) secretion, largely through the anion exchanger pendrin.
